RequestCreditOrders
Request a list of all credit orders
Request format
{
"RequestId": "0f4760f7-a57c-4dfb-8f1f-2b8ccca9d550",
"Search": "usa",
"AccountsGroups": [
"real",
"demo"
],
"Countries": [
"Russia",
"USA"
],
"PageSize": 100,
"PageNum": 1,
"Nodes": [
"node1",
"node2"
],
"RequestName": "RequestCreditOrders"
}
Request parameters:
| Name | Description |
|---|---|
| RequestId | Unique request GUID |
| Search | Order filter, works for the fields Order, Login, Group, Country, Currency, Symbol, Comment |
| AccountsGroups | List of account groups |
| Countries | List of countries |
| PageSize | Number of records per page |
| PageNum | Page number (first page - 1) |
| Nodes | List of nodes that participate in the request. If the list is empty, then all available nodes are called. |
| RequestName | Request type |
Response ResponseActiveOrders
{
"Result": {
"Page": [
{
"Deal": 222222,
"Timestamp": "2024-01-17 00:00:00:000",
"TimeMsc": "2024-01-17 10:36:30:616",
"Login": 11111,
"AccountGroup": "demo\\demo1",
"Action": "CREDIT",
"Profit": 1500,
"ProfitInUsd": 1500,
"ClientCommissionInUsd": 0,
"BrokerCommissionInUsd": 0,
"Comment": "Credit In",
"IsReal": true,
"UpdateTimeUtc": "0001-01-01 00:00:00:000",
"Reason": "Dealer",
"CloseTime": "2024-01-17 10:36:30:616",
"Currency": "USD",
"IsIncludedToSessionPnL": false,
"Node": "node1",
"Platform": "Mt5",
"Country": "Isle of Man",
"IsExpiredCredit": false
},
{
"Deal": 3333333,
"Timestamp": "2021-09-17 00:00:00:000",
"TimeMsc": "2021-09-17 14:03:23:000",
"Login": 5555555,
"AccountGroup": "AllgroupTEST",
"Action": "CREDIT",
"Profit": 44560,
"ProfitInUsd": 44560,
"ClientCommissionInUsd": 0,
"BrokerCommissionInUsd": 0,
"Comment": "test1",
"IsReal": true,
"UpdateTimeUtc": "0001-01-01 00:00:00:000",
"Reason": "Client",
"CloseTime": "2031-09-17 14:03:20:000",
"Currency": "USD",
"IsIncludedToSessionPnL": false,
"Node": "node3",
"Platform": "Mt4",
"Country": "",
"IsExpiredCredit": false
}
],
"PageSize": 15,
"PageNum": 1,
"TotalRecords": 265
},
"RequestId": "31bc135c-a4eb-45a9-9f98-822c1ba0830c",
"Errors": [],
"ResponseMaster": "ResponseCreditOrders"
}
Errors are either an empty list or a list of responses of the ResponseNodeError nodes